About the event
Join OCC members on a visit to the ROM Wildlife Photographer of the Year Exhibit. Recognized as the world's longest-running and most prestigious annual nature photography competition, the exhibit attracts the world's best nature photography. One hundred photographs from this year's competition will be on display. The ROM visit will be followed by photo walk in the neighbourhood, weather permitting.
